Mechanic & Repair Technologies is one of the most popular subjects to study in Idaho. With 504 degrees and certificates handed out in 2021-2022, it ranked 4th out of all the majors we track in the state.
There are lots of options to pick from today when trying to decide which trade school program is right for you. You can choose a traditional brick and mortar school, or with the growth of online education, you can attend a school half-way across the country without even leaving your house.
To assist you in seeing some of the education options that are available to you, Trade College Search has created its Most Popular Mechanic & Repair Technologies Trade Schools in Idaho ranking. This report analyzed 7 schools in Idaho to see which ones were the most popular programs for trade school students. To create this ranking we looked at how many students graduated from the Mechanic & Repair Technologies program at each school on the list.

Our 2023 rankings named College of Western Idaho the most popular school in Idaho for mechanic & repair technologies students. CWI is a moderately-sized public school located in the rural area of Nampa.

The excellent programs at Idaho State University helped the school earn the #2 place on this year’s ranking of the best mechanic & repair technologies schools in Idaho. ISU is a large public school located in the small city of Pocatello.

Out of the 7 schools in Idaho that were part of this year’s ranking, College of Southern Idaho landed the # 3 spot on the list. Located in the remote town of Twin Falls, College of Southern Idaho is a public college with a medium-sized student population.
